Will PBBM protect Dela Rosa?

Stressing that everyone is given protection in accordance with the law, Malacañang assured that if Senator Ronald "Bato" dela Rosa, who is now wanted for crimes against humanity, is arrested, he will receive protection.
"Kung naaresto man po siya, kung maaaresto man po siya, lahat ng karapatan bilang isang akusado ay ibibigay po sa kanya (If he is arrested, all the rights accorded to an accused person will be granted to him)," Palace Press Officer and Communications Undersecretary Claire Castro said in a briefing on Tuesday, May 12.
Castro underscored that the victims of extrajudicial killings (EJK) are also seeking protection from the government, stressing that they, too, deserved to be protected.
"Maski naman po iyong mga EJK victims ay humihingi rin po ng proteksyon sa gobyerno. So, ang akusadong katulad ni Senator Bato ay humihingi ng proteksyon, lahat naman po ay bibigyan ng proteksyon na naaayon sa batas (Even the victims of EJK are also seeking protection from the government. So if an accused person like Senator Bato is asking for protection, everyone will be given protection in accordance with the law)," Castro said.
On Tuesday, a day after he finally showed up at the Senate, Dela Rosa appealed to President Marcos for protection after the International Criminal Court (ICC) confirmed that there was indeed an arrest warrant issued against him over crimes against humanity in connection with at least 32 killings allegedly committed during the Duterte administration’s anti-drug campaign.

Privilege has limitations

Before asking for the President's protection, Dela Rosa was already placed under protective custody by the Senate.
Castro pointed out that while Senators enjoy a privilege wherein they cannot be arrested while the Senate is in session, they must know that such privilege has limitations.
"Mayroon pong tinatawag na privilege para hindi po hulihin ang sinumang senador habang nasa session kapag siya po ay nasa vicinity ng Senado. But alam po natin na ito ay may limitasyon (There is what we call a privilege that prevents any senator from being arrested while in session and while the senator is within the vicinity of the Senate. But we know that this privilege has limitations)," Castro said.
"Kapag po ang isang krimen na nagawa ay may penalty na more than six years, hindi po mag-a-apply itong pribilehiyo na ito (If a crime carries a penalty of more than six years, this privilege does not apply)," Castro added.
The Palace mouthpiece also said that the Senators must know the law, since they are lawmakers, and they must also know the limitation o f their power.
"Welll, ayaw nating pangunahan ang mga senador but dapat alam nila kung ano ang batas kasi mambabatas sila. So, alam nila kung ano ang limitasyon nila, ano lang iyong kanilang authority, ano lang iyong power nila but they should not go beyond the law (Well, we do not want to preempt the senators, but they should know what the law says because they are lawmakers. So they know what their limitations are, what their authority is, and what powers they have, but they should not go beyond the law)," Castro said.
While appealing for protection, Dela Rosa also urged the President to reflect as the day may come that he might also end up in the senator's situation.
Castro said, "That’s definitely impossible" because "the President did not commit EJK."

'Follow the law'

While Marcos has not yet issued a direct order in relation to the arrest of Dela Rosa, the President wants law enforcers to follow the law.
"Nabalitaan po ng Pangulo ang nangyari kahapon. At ang lagi naman pong utos ng Pangulo sa lahat ng enforcement agencies sa lahat po ng pagkakataon, hindi lamang po dito patungkol kay Senator Bato, dapat lamang ay sumunod kung ano ang sinasabi ng batas (The President learned about what happened yesterday. And the President’s standing directive to all enforcement agencies, in all situations not only in matters concerning Senator Ronald "Bato" dela Rosa, is that they must simply follow what the law says)," Castro said.
She explained that the Philippines has two options in Dela Rosa's case: to surrender or to extradite. But since extradition can occur only between two states and the ICC is not a state, the country can enforce only Republic Act No. 9851, the Philippine Act on Crimes Against International Humanitarian Law, Genocide, and Other Crimes Against Humanity.
According to Castro, since the Philippines is no longer a member of the ICC, Republic Act No. 9851 is the law that applies to Dela Rosa’s case.
"Ang umiiral po na batas sa atin ay ang RA 9851. At iyon po ang ipapatupad sa anumang pagkakataon dahil ito naman pong RA 9851 ay nagamit na rin po ng Supreme Court sa ibang mga kaso (The law that applies to us is Republic Act 9851. And that is what will be enforced in any situation because the Supreme Court has also already used RA 9851 in other cases)," Castro said.
The Palace official also pointed out that the country has an obligation to the Interpol and to all victims of EJK.
"Ang nagsampa po kasi ng kaso sa ICC ay kapwa natin Pilipino. At mayroon din po tayong obligasyon sa Interpol, mayroon din po tayong obligasyon na ang lahat ng dapat na managot ay managot dahil dapat din po nating proteksyunan iyong mga diumano na nabiktima ng EJK (The ones who filed the case before the ICC are also Filipinos. We also have obligations to Interpol, and we likewise have an obligation to ensure that all those who should be held accountable are held accountable, because we must also protect those who were allegedly victims of EJK)," Castro stressed.
"At ayon sa RA 9851, at maliwanag ito sa Section 17, na kung mayroon na pong nakapagsimula na state or international tribunal patungkol sa pag-iimbestiga ay puwede nating i-defer, puwede nating i-waive iyong ating karapatan at ibigay na sa international court ang pagpapaimbestiga, at iyon naman din po ang sinusunod ng RA natin, dito sa RA 9851 (And under RA 9851, as clearly stated in Section 17, if a state or an international tribunal has already initiated an investigation, we may defer or waive our jurisdiction and allow the international court to proceed with the investigation. And that is also what our RA 9851 provides)," Castro explained.
Dela Rosa was accused by the ICC of crimes against humanity in connection with the killings allegedly committed during the Duterte administration's war on drugs. He was then the chief of the Philippine National Police (PNP), which was the key implementer of the drug war campaign.
The ICC confirmed on Monday that it issued an arrest warrant against Dela Rosa, who had been absent from the Senate for six months before appearing on Monday.
